🧄 Ingredients (Serves 12–16)
For the Cake:
White cake mix (15.25 oz)
1 box
Classic vanilla or butter golden
Crushed pineapple (undrained)
1 (8 oz) can
Juice included — don’t drain!
Granulated sugar
1 cup
For extra sweetness and texture
Vanilla extract
½ tsp
Enhances flavor
✅ Optional twist: Add 1 mashed ripe banana for an extra Elvis touch.
For the Cream Cheese Frosting:
Cream cheese, softened
8 oz
Full-fat for best texture
Butter, softened
½ cup (1 stick)
Unsalted
Powdered sugar
3 cups
Sifted, for smoothness
Vanilla extract
½ tsp
For flavor depth
For the Topping:
Crushed pecans
3 cups
Toasted for extra flavor (optional)
✅ Nut-free? Swap with crushed graham crackers or coconut.
🥣 Step-by-Step: How to Make Elvis Presley Cake
Step 1: Preheat & Prep
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C)
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ish — no parchment needed (the nuts will stick)
Step 2: Make the Cake Batter
In the prepared pan, mix:
Cake mix
Crushed pineapple (with juice)
Granulated sugar
Vanilla extract
Stir with a spoon until smooth and fully combined
No mixer needed — just mix right in the pan!
Bake 35–40 minutes, until a toothpick comes out clean
✅ Don’t overbake — the pineapple keeps it moist.
Step 3: Make the Frosting
In a bowl, beat:
Cream cheese
Butter
Until smooth and fluffy
Gradually add powdered sugar and vanilla
Beat until creamy and spreadable
✅ Too thick? Add 1 tsp milk.
✅ Too thin? Chill 10 mins.
Step 4: Frost & Top
Let cake cool completely — warm cake melts frosting
Spread frosting evenly over the top
Press crushed pecans into the frosting — all over the top
✅ Pro Tip: Use the back of a spoon to press nuts in gently.
Step 5: Slice & Serve
Cut into squares — each bite should be moist, sweet, and nutty
Serve at room temperature
Pair with:
Iced tea
Coffee
Or a glass of milk and a little Elvis on the radio
Leftovers? Store covered at room temp for 2 days, or refrigerate for up to 5 days — bring to room temp before serving.
🧑🍳 Pro Tips for the Best Elvis Cake Every Time
Don’t drain the pineapple
The juice adds moisture and flavor
Toast the pecans
5 mins at 350°F = deeper, nuttier taste
Cool the cake completely
Prevents melted, messy frosting
Make it ahead
Flavors deepen overnight
Add banana
For a true Elvis twist — mash 1 ripe banana into the batter
